Canvas Network offers open, online courses taught by educators everywhere. Powered by the Canvas LMS and Canvas Catalog, Canvas Network provides a place and platform where teachers, students, and institutions worldwide can connect and chart their own course for personal growth, professional development, and academic inquiry.

Since its launch in 2013, Canvas Network has offered more than 400 open, online courses designed and delivered by over 150 educational institutions and organizations throughout the world. Canvas Network is developed and supported by Instructure, the technology company that makes smart software that makes people smarter. Learn (or teach) more at www.Canvas.Net.
